Description
Wear-resistant flow regulating valve Technical Field The application relates to the technical field of valves, in particular to a wear-resistant flow regulating valve. Background The flow regulating valve acts on the regulation of medium and low pressure such as ore pulp, waste water and the like and uses, and this product simple structure is durable, and convenient to use is nimble, and stand wear and tear flow regulating valve is a valve that is used for controlling fluid flow specially, has good wear resistance, and stand wear and tear flow regulating valve controls the flow of medium in the body through the aperture of regulating valve. The working principle of the valve is similar to that of a common flow regulating valve, but the valve can better cope with the working condition with serious abrasion by adopting wear-resistant materials and structural design. At present, the publication date is 2023, 11 and 14, the Chinese patent application with publication number CN 220016143U provides a flow regulating valve, which comprises a valve body, a pipe body and a rotating mechanism, wherein the valve body comprises a pipe body, a valve cover, a screw, a sealing ring and a nut, the pipe body is arranged on the upper surface of the valve body, the pipe body extends to the bottom of the valve body, the pipe body comprises a flange, a water inlet pipe and a water outlet pipe, the water inlet pipe is arranged on the outer side wall of the bottom of the valve body, the water outlet pipe is arranged on the outer side wall of the valve body far away from the water inlet pipe, the water outlet pipe, the valve body and the water inlet pipe are arranged on the coaxial line, the valve body is positioned between the water outlet pipe and the water inlet pipe, and the water outlet pipe, the valve body and the water inlet pipe are mutually communicated. According to the utility model, through the arrangement of the threaded rod, the rotating ring and the valve clack, the threaded rod is in threaded connection with the middle part of the valve cover, so that the distance of movement of the valve clack can be controlled more accurately, and the inflow of water body can be controlled more accurately. Through the setting of threaded rod, swivel becket and valve clack, such structure is constituteed simpler, and processing cost is lower, and the practicality is stronger. The flow regulating valve in the related art has poor sealing performance, which can cause fluid leakage, thus not only wasting resources, but also polluting the environment and even causing safety accidents. Because of the poor sealing properties resulting in fluid leakage or loss, the system needs to consume more energy to maintain proper operation, thereby increasing energy waste. Poor tightness can lead to increased wear of the parts such as the sealing element, the valve core, the valve seat and the like in the valve, thereby shortening the service life of the valve. There is a need to provide a wear resistant flow regulating valve that addresses the above-described issues. Disclosure of utility model The embodiment of the application provides a wear-resistant flow regulating valve, which aims to solve the technical problems that the sealing performance of the flow regulating valve is poor, the fluid leakage is caused, the energy waste is increased, the service life of the flow regulating valve is shortened, and the maintenance cost is increased in the related art.
